Ripple Effect

Rush of the sugared breeze. Palms up. Washing like sweet water over me. Dark greens fade into lighter shades of itself. The wind crawls through the blades of grass, A snake in it’s true form. A mountain blue sky traces and cuts white Clouds across the canvas. I carry a salty taste on my skin. The marble water sits away from me, Nested in the trees beyond. Open space seeps into my mind, Flowing through time and purpose. Breathe steady and unmeasured With the air. Eyes drifting over the distance, This is why I came.
